WebFeb 21, 2024 · 1. High self-esteem is not just liking yourself but generally affording yourself love, value, dignity, and respect, too. Positive self-esteem also means believing in your capability (to learn, achieve, and contribute to the world) and autonomy to do things on your own. 2 It means you think your ideas, feelings, and opinions have worth.
